Pinot bianco

i Feudi di Romans

      specifications

 
sovran

Classification

D.O.C. ISONZO

Grape Variety

100% Pinot Blanc (Bianco) grapes.

History

Originating in France, this grapevine has been widely cultivated in Friuli, second in abundance after Tocai. Perhaps already present in Roman times, this variety is a germinated mutation of Pinot Noir (Nero).

Characteristics

Colour of yellow straw with green reflections. Pleasant and elegant bouquet, rich in nuance recalling wildflowers, artemisia, cherry, apricot and apple. It is our experience that as it ages, notes of pasture herbs, aromatic leaves, and dried fruit come forth in Pinot Bianco’s bouquet.

Vinification

The grapes, gathered at a temperature of 25°C, upon arrival in the winery were immediately separated, by rotation and compression, from the cluster, then softly pressed. Must chilled at 15°C. Settling overnight. Pouring of the must cleaned by inoculation of selected yeast. Fermentation at 18°C for 9 days. Decanting. Ageing in stainless steel vats.

Vineyard Statistics

1,5 hectares at Romàns. 4.200 vines per hectare.

Availability

12,000 bottles.

Serving temperature

12-14° C.
